waza design is a creative space where I explore shapes, colors, and materials, which sometimes play tricks on me, leaving room for surprise.
Through jewelry made of colorful plexiglas, I experiment with transparency, modularity, and endless possibilities. I create bold and distinctive pieces.
But my work goes beyond jewelry. I’m also interested in graphic design through lines, layering, and the unexpected. I enjoy developing other object-based projects, with the desire to create pieces that feel alive and sensitive.
